Team News: Charlie Austin misses out for Queens Park Rangers with calf injury

A calf injury keeps Charlie Austin out of the Queens Park Rangers side for their meeting with Middlesbrough.

Charlie Austin is out of the Queens Park Rangers side for their meeting with Middlesbrough due to a calf injury.

Despite it only being a minor problem for the striker, Austin misses out for the visitors and Matt Phillips is given the responsibility of leading the line.

Junior Hoilett is rested after being away with Canada during the international break, while Jay Emmanuel-Thomas is forced to settle for a spot on the bench as Kevin Blackwell takes charge in the absence of caretaker boss Neil Warnock.

Kike and Christian Stuani are among the substitutes for Middlesbrough, with David Nugent starting in attack for the hosts.

Fernando Amorebieta is unavailable due to injury as Emilio Nsue and Ben Gibson start in central defence.
